I want to share my experience, doctor. I know that a sample size of n=1 has no scientific value, but I have found a treatment that works very well for me, although it works extremely slowly. Something fell into my eye, and since then, I saw pitch-black small circle-shaped spots in the corner of my eye, moving like a swarm of flies. It drove me crazy. I could perceive each floater individually (there were very few of them). Under the motto "if it doesn’t help, it won’t hurt," I (after a few months) repeated a Taiwanese study (Dr. Jui-Wen Ma et al.), in which not pineapple but a very high concentration of fruit enzymes (including bromelain from pineapples, but also other enzymes like ficin and papain) was administered to patients over a three-month period. What gave me hope was that X-rays were also included in the study, and it seemed unlikely to me that a team of Ph.D. scientists would have fabricated the entire study and photoshopped the images. Since I didn't want to deceive myself, I kept a diary in which I described my floaters daily. My pitch-dark, circular floaters became progressively lighter brown and more transparent. Additionally, they lost more and more shape. When I first noticed the changes, I wrote down "it seems that…" but now I can no longer deny it, because after about 3.5 months, I can no longer distinguish my floaters. Instead of seeing them all day (especially in bright light), I now only occasionally see "something" move in the corner of my eye. And when I try to find the now-transparent, small floater spots in bright light, sometimes I can't even locate them. I am aware that your brain can ignore floaters over time, but that doesn't explain how I witnessed changes that strongly suggest I was observing a process in which protein fibers were being broken down. I am also aware that fruit enzymes hardly reach the eye, but that could explain why the breakdown process is so incredibly slow and why it works better with a very high dose. As a layperson in this field, I have no clue HOW it works, but as a patient, I have experienced THAT it works. Because I only started this treatment after months and then suddenly saw progress, I believe there is a connection between the treatment and the progress. I hope that more scientists will replicate the study, because then I think scientific consensus will follow quickly.

A great video. I had posterior vitreous detachment and a retinal horseshoe tear which was tacked down. There are different classes of floaters. One, are the vitreous gel floaters caused by collagen clumping during syneresis or formation of liquefied vitreous. A more serious type are caused by posterior vitreous detachment…hyaloid membrane surrounding the vitreous pulls from the retina, and parts of that can cause more obstructing floaters. If the hyaloid pulls too hard, causing traction and visual flashing lights, the retina can tear. Many hundreds of dark tiny floaters can accompany this. Flashing lights, dark curtains, and loss of acuity signals possible retinal tears. These can generally be tacked down right away with a laser…a barrier is formed to prevent further tearing.

It sounds like Posterior Viterous Detachment. The gel in the Viterous sac liquefies and the sac pulls away from the Retina. Long stringy floaters that are black, brown, or nearly transparent in your visional field is common if you have PVD. These floaters don't go away. In the less severe cases you get use to it and may not notice it as much. For severe cases where you have many floaters that is affecting your vision there a surgery called a Vitrectomy. What they do with that surgery is drain the viterous sac and remove all the particles that are responsible for the floaters and refill the sac with saline solution. Please see a Retina Specialist about this condition as it is possible to have a Retinal Detachment if you are very near sighted. It is a small percentage of that happening, but it could happen.
